org.crsh.connector
Class ShellConnector

java.lang.Object
  extended by org.crsh.connector.ShellConnector

public class ShellConnector
extends java.lang.Object

Version:
$Revision$
Author:
Julien Viet

Constructor Summary
ShellConnector(ShellBuilder builder)
           
 
Method Summary
 boolean cancelEvalutation()
           
 void close()
           
 java.lang.String evaluate(java.lang.String request)
           
 java.lang.String getPrompt()
           
 ConnectorStatus getStatus()
           
 boolean isClosed()
           
 java.lang.String open()
           
 java.lang.String popResponse()
           
 void submitEvaluation(java.lang.String request)
           
 void submitEvaluation(java.lang.String request, CompletionHandler<java.lang.String> handler)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ShellConnector

public ShellConnector(ShellBuilder builder)
Method Detail

isClosed

public boolean isClosed()

open

public java.lang.String open()

getPrompt

public java.lang.String getPrompt()

getStatus

public ConnectorStatus getStatus()

submitEvaluation

public void submitEvaluation(java.lang.String request)

submitEvaluation

public void submitEvaluation(java.lang.String request,
                             CompletionHandler<java.lang.String> handler)

cancelEvalutation

public boolean cancelEvalutation()

popResponse

public java.lang.String popResponse()

evaluate

public java.lang.String evaluate(java.lang.String request)

close

public void close()


Copyright © 2010 eXo Platform SAS. All Rights Reserved.